History A 55-year-old female with a 2-year history of vertical diplopia. Previous history significant for hypertension, MI and symptoms of intermittent claudication in the legs that led to the Dx fibromuscular dysplasia of the renal and iliac arteries.
Pathology Thyroid ophthalmopathy
Disease/Diagnosis Graves Ophthalmopathy
Clinical VA: 20/20 OU
Presenting Symptom Diplopia
